# 如何在Python中执行CMD命令并获取进程ID ## 概述 在Python中,我们可以使用`os`模块来执行CMD命令,并通过一些技巧来获取进程ID。这里我们将向你展示如何实现这一操作。 ## 步骤概览 以下是完成该任务的整体步骤概览。我们将使用一个表格来展示每个具体步骤的内容。 | 步骤 | 操作 | | --- | --- | | 1 | 导入`os`模块 | | 2 | 执行CM
原创 2024-06-27 06:26:35
85阅读
# 监控和启动CMD进程Python脚本 在开发和管理计算机系统时,我们经常需要监控和控制运行的进程。本文将介绍如何使用Python编写一个脚本来监控CMD进程,并在需要时启动新的CMD进程。 ## CMD进程简介 CMD(命令提示符)是Windows操作系统中的命令行界面。通过CMD,用户可以执行各种操作系统命令和程序。监控CMD进程可以帮助我们了解系统中正在运行的命令行任务,以及它们的
原创 2023-08-13 09:37:13
455阅读
1首先我们点击我们的开始菜单,在开始菜单中安装的python目录下点击‘IDLE(Python 3.6 64-bit)‘,进入IDLE,如下图:2下图中的界面就是IDLE的界面,我们可以在这个界面中进行python的变成,在下图的窗口中可以看到‘>>>’IDLE已经准备好了,我们进行python的编写就在‘>>>’之后,如下图:3这里我们在IDLE中使用一个pr
# 如何实现Java获取多个cmd进程ID ## 流程概览 下面是获取多个cmd进程ID的整体流程: | 步骤 | 描述 | | --- | --- | | 1 | 调用系统命令获取所有cmd进程信息 | | 2 | 解析命令输出,提取进程ID | | 3 | 将进程ID保存在一个列表中 | ## 代码实现 ### 步骤1:调用系统命令获取所有cmd进程信息 ```java // 使用
原创 2024-04-21 04:32:51
74阅读
首先利用window+R组合键,调出命令窗口以下是开启一个web程序  端口为8080 .输入命令:netstat -ano,列出所有端口的情况。在列表中我们观察被占用的端口,找到8080.                      或者使用netstat -aon|findstr "端口" (查看具体哪个端口被占用 ) 在使用命令:  tasklist|findst
转载 2023-05-24 15:02:12
246阅读
 知识点一:进程的理论 进程:正在进行的一个程序或者说一个任务,而负责执行任务的则是CPU 进程运行的的三种状态: 1.运行:(由CPU来执行,越多越好,可提高效率) 2.阻塞:(遇到了IQ,3个里面可以通过减少阻塞有效的来提高效率) 3.就绪:(等待CPU来执行的过程)  知识点二:开启进程的两种方式  开启进程:开启进程就是将父进程里面串行执行的程序放到子进
         最近在写一个进程监控管理的程序,需求是这样的:在后台监控一个名字为links.exe的进程,由于此进程会出现不定期的挂起(无响应),但有没有任何消息提示,要求写一个的程序,在后台时刻监视着links.exe进程的状态,如果发现挂起,则强制将其结束,然后重新启动一个挂掉的进程(要求参数一致)。     
转载 2023-10-12 21:46:36
53阅读
## 实现dockerfile中CMD启动docker进程 ### 概述 在使用Docker构建镜像时,我们可以使用dockerfile来定义镜像的构建过程。其中,CMD指令用于在容器启动时执行指定的命令或程序。本文将介绍如何在dockerfile中使用CMD指令启动docker进程。 ### 流程 下表展示了在dockerfile中使用CMD指令启动docker进程的流程: | 步骤
原创 2024-01-10 09:18:38
81阅读
对 powershell 做下总结 启动 powershell #字符串操作 对象操作 "hello".Length #进程操作 PS C:/> notepad PS C:/> $process=get-process notepad PS C:/> $process.Kill() #默认对象操作 PS C:/> 40GB/650MB 63.015
转载 2024-06-06 19:32:39
41阅读
# 如何实现“Java启动exe进程id” ## 引言 在Java开发中,有时候我们需要启动一个外部的可执行文件(exe)并获取它的进程ID,以便后续操作。本文将带你了解如何使用Java代码实现这个功能。 ## 实现过程概述 在实现这个功能之前,我们需要先了解整个流程。下面的表格展示了实现这个功能的步骤: | 步骤 | 描述 | | --- | --- | | 步骤一 | 构建进程创建器 |
原创 2024-01-20 07:28:38
79阅读
在使用Linux系统中,经常需要启动一些进程来运行各种应用程序,其中Tomcat作为一个常用的Java应用程序服务器,经常在Linux环境下被使用。在启动Tomcat的过程中,会生成一个与该进程相关的ID,也就是进程ID(PID),这对于管理和监控Tomcat进程非常重要。接下来我们就来探讨一下Linux环境下Tomcat启动进程ID的相关知识。 在Linux系统中,每个运行的进程都有一个唯一的
原创 2024-05-30 11:01:23
145阅读
# 如何在Java中打印启动进程ID ## 简介 作为一名经验丰富的开发者,你可能会经常需要在Java应用程序中获取启动进程ID。而对于刚入行的小白来说,这可能是一个比较陌生的概念。在本篇文章中,我将教会你如何在Java中打印启动进程ID。 ## 流程 以下是整个过程的步骤,我们可以用表格展示出来: | 步骤 | 描述
原创 2024-07-05 05:56:06
36阅读
Java执行cmd命令启动进程 C:\Users\Administrator>net stop mysqlmysql 服务正在停止..mysql 服务已成功停止。
原创 2021-07-07 14:39:52
622阅读
Java执行cmd命令启动进程 C:\Users\Administrator>net stop mysqlmysql 服务正在停止..mysql 服务已成功停止。C:\Users\Administrator>mysql -u root -pEnter passwor\
原创 2022-01-28 09:56:01
518阅读
用windows学习编程的同鞋一定少不了一个操作:启动cmd命令行,有时候还要右键用管理员方式启动,如果操作多了心态真的容易爆炸,今天告诉大家一个1秒启动命令行的方法。我用的win10系统,其他系统可不可行大家可以自己试试。按win+s键呼出搜索栏:输入cmd或者命令行右键打开文件位置我们可以看到这几个快捷方式:选中命令行右键打开属性(或者按住alt双击鼠标左键也可以打开属性)在快捷方式的快捷键选
1 终端:在UNIX系统中,用户通过终端登录系统后得到一个Shell进程,这个终端成为Shell进程的控制终端(Controlling Terminal),进程中,控制终端是保存在PCB中的信息,而fork会复制PCB中的信息,因此由Shell进程启动的其它进程的控制终端也是这个终端。默认情况下(没有重定向),每个进程的标准输入、标准输出和标准错误输出都指向控制终端,进程从标准输入读也就是读用户的
# Python 启动命令并获取启动后的进程id 在日常开发和运维工作中,经常会遇到需要启动一个 Python 程序并获取其进程 id 的情况。这样可以方便我们进行进程管理、监控和日志追踪等操作。本文将介绍如何通过启动命令启动一个 Python 程序,并获取其进程 id。 ## 启动 Python 程序 在 Linux 系统中,我们可以通过命令行启动一个 Python 程序。假设我们有一个名
原创 2024-06-28 06:32:00
73阅读
一周前,我介绍了 从那时起,我意识到也许人们对C的编程不那么多。也许人们用Java编写程序! 在这里,我介绍了三种不同的从Java运行Python程序的选项。 首先使用(旧的)Runtime类,然后使用ProcessBuilder类,最后使用Jython(用Java编写的Python解释器)将Python代码嵌入Java。 运行时方法 首先,使用Runtime类,这是做旧方法。 impo
转载 2023-05-30 16:47:51
56阅读
### 终止Python cmd进程 在进行Python开发调试过程中,经常会使用命令行界面(CMD)来执行Python脚本。然而,有时候我们可能需要提前终止正在运行的Python CMD进程。本文将介绍如何终止Python CMD进程,并提供相关的代码示例。 #### 1. 终止进程的概念 在介绍如何终止Python CMD进程之前,我们先来了解一下什么是进程进程是指计算机中正在运行的一
原创 2024-01-27 07:14:01
74阅读
# 使用CMD查看Python进程 在开发和运行Python程序时,有时我们可能需要查看正在运行的Python进程。这可以帮助我们了解程序的执行情况,以及可能存在的问题。接下来,我们将介绍如何使用CMD(命令提示符)来查看Python进程,并给出相应的代码示例。 ## CMD概述 CMD(命令提示符)是Windows操作系统中的一个命令行工具,通过它我们可以执行各种命令,包括查看和管理正在运
原创 2023-09-12 10:23:42
311阅读
  • 1
  • 2
  • 3
  • 4
  • 5